Iron Profile Variability in Hemodialysis Chronic Kidney Disease Patients
This study investigates the differences in iron profile parameters between dialysis‐adherent and non‐adherent chronic kidney disease patients. Results show that adherence to dialysis is significantly associated with improved iron status—including higher serum ferritin, TSAT, and hemoglobin levels—and a lower prevalence of iron deficiency anemia ...

Serum Ferritin: An Indicator of Disease Severity in Patients with Dengue Infection
Background: Serum ferritin levels are usually raised in dengue virus infection. This study was conducted to see the association of raised serum ferritin levels on the day of admission with the disease severity.
